Hands-On Impressions

In my testing, the impact driver was excellent for quickly driving screws into dense materials, especially in tight spots where space is limited. Its lightweight feel reduced fatigue during extended use. The drill, on the other hand, proved very capable for drilling holes and driving fasteners in various materials, thanks to its two-speed transmission and brushless motor. Both tools felt durable and well-built, with intuitive controls and bright LED lights that made working in low-light conditions easier.

Performance in Real-World Use

During my testing, I found that the impact driver delivered impressive torque, making repetitive screw-driving tasks effortless. It handled deck screws and lag bolts with ease, and the quick-change hex chuck sped up my workflow. The impact driver’s compact size allowed me to work in confined spaces without fatigue. The drill was equally effective for drilling through wood, metal, and plastic, with the two-speed settings giving me control over speed and power. It also handled driving larger fasteners without bogging down, demonstrating its versatile capabilities.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use the impact driver for drilling?

While the impact driver can handle some light drilling with the right bits, it is primarily designed for fastening. For most drilling tasks, especially larger holes, the drill is more suitable.

How long do the batteries last during heavy use?

Battery life varies depending on the workload. The impact driver’s batteries tend to last through repetitive fastening, while the drill’s brushless motor helps extend runtime during demanding drilling tasks.

Are these tools compatible with other DEWALT 20V MAX batteries?

Yes, both tools are compatible with DEWALT’s 20V MAX battery platform, allowing you to interchange batteries across different models.

Which tool is better for professional use?

Both are durable and reliable, but the drill’s versatility and longer runtime make it more suitable for a wider range of professional tasks. The impact driver is excellent for quick fastening jobs.
